8.2 Code Protection
If the code protection bit(s) have not been
programmed, the on-chip program memory can be
read out using ICSP™ for verification purposes.
Note:
The entire Flash program memory will be
erased when the code protection is turned
off. See the “PIC16(L)F720/721 Memory
Programming Specification” (DS41409)
for more information.
8.3 User ID
Four memory locations (2000h-2003h) are designated
as ID locations where the user can store checksum or
other code identification numbers. These locations are
not accessible during normal execution, but are read-
able and writable during Program/Verify mode. Only
the Least Significant 7 bits of the ID locations are
reported when using MPLAB® IDE. See the
“PIC16(L)F720/721 Memory Programming Specifica-
tion” (DS41409) for more information.
